What you will be doing:
⦁ Owning pricing analytics, at a category-level, to drive insights and actions for the Commercial Team
⦁ Reviewing price trends over time across Jumia / Online Competition / Offline Competition, to identify and flag actions to commercial team
⦁ Incorporating insights from findings of pricing associates to drive pricing recommendations for Sales Teams on prices
⦁ Developing price elasticity data and toolkit at a category-, sub-category and SKU-level to determine highest ROI for internal investments on price
⦁ Owning the website front-end from A-Z, with a strong eye for details - everything on the website is your responsibility
⦁ Driving the optimization of overall Conversion Rate and key Onsite KPIs across all devices and Onsite channels - desktop, mobile and app
⦁ Working with teams (Design, Marketing, Operations, etc.) across the company to coordinate, evaluate and implement onsite requests
⦁ Monitoring, analysing, optimizing and reporting on performance of products, categories and campaigns to generate key learnings and actionable recommendations, to maximize future results and drive business performance
⦁ Being a source of innovative ideas for onsite optimization, keeping up to date with new ecommerce ideas and innovations to implement on Jumia
⦁ Participating in weekly campaign planning to monitor for efficient merchandising, including: challenging product assortment and reviewing catalog structure & navigation, to optimize user experience and drive sales
